Refine Your Medicare Home Health Billing

Medicare home health billing is ever-changing -- and ever-challenging. You have a plethora of constantly evolving Medicare home health billing adjustments, as well as Medicare claims corrections every year. Between OASIS issues to episode payment variances, you have your hands full when it comes to Medicare home health billing.

Stay Up-to-Date on Home Health PPS Refinements

One surefire way to get a handle on your medicare home health billing is to know the ins and outs of the home health PPS refinements every year. Understanding the changes in store for each year's PPS billing processes will enable you to avoid billing errors and claims adjustments.

If your Medicare home health payments don't match your claims, you probably missed a key update to the home health PPS. Also, you could wait a long time before Medicare implements claims corrections for any previous claims processing errors.

Medicare Home Health Billing Doesn't Have to Be a Nightmare

Keeping in the loop on certain key changes that CMS hands down can work wonders on your Medicare home health billing processes. Aside from the home health PPS revisions and updates, here's what else you should stay on top of:

  • Any new CMS guidance issued for Medicare home health billing;
  • New or revised HCPCS, CPT and ICD-9 codes for home health;
  • New or changed guidance from CMS specifically on reprocessed payments or payment errors; and
  • Any new standards regarding your Medicare home health billing practices that may impact your compliance and/or reimbursements.
